The Ohio State University invites applications for a full-time Post Doctoral Scholar position in Dr. Christina Dyar’s lab. The overarching goal of Dr. Dyar’s lab is to advance our understanding of psychological mechanisms through which different types of stigma-related stressors (e.g., discrimination, microaggressions) impact mental health and substance use among LGBTQ+ individuals.

The Postdoctoral Scholar will contribute to ongoing projects in Dr. Dyar’s lab (e.g., cross-sectional, longitudinal, and ecological momentary assessment studies of stigma, mental health, and substance use among LGBTQ+). They will also have opportunities to analyze existing data, to author and co-author manuscripts, and to gain exposure to and mentorship on grant writing.
